School Overview
Cedar Springs Elementary is a public school located in House Springs, Missouri, serving students within the Northwest R-I School District. Situated in a suburban setting on Rivermont Trails, the school provides educational services for elementary-aged children, focusing on foundational academic development, social-emotional growth, and community building within the local area.
As part of the Northwest R-I district, the school emphasizes a comprehensive curriculum designed to prepare students for the transition to middle school. The campus acts as a central hub for families in the House Springs community, often hosting school-sponsored events and extracurricular activities that aim to foster a collaborative environment between educators, parents, and students.
